diff --git a/drivers/firmware/tegra/Makefile b/drivers/firmware/tegra/Makefile index d67b38e1..5bbfae69 100644 --- a/drivers/firmware/tegra/Makefile +++ b/drivers/firmware/tegra/Makefile @@ -14,7 +14,7 @@ obj-m += ivc_ext.o tegra_bpmp-y += ../../clk/tegra/clk-bpmp.o tegra_bpmp-y += ../../reset/tegra/reset-bpmp.o tegra_bpmp-y += ../../soc/tegra/powergate-bpmp.o -tegra_bpmp-y += bpmp-debugfs.o +tegra_bpmp-$(CONFIG_DEBUG_FS) += bpmp-debugfs.o tegra_bpmp-y += bpmp-tegra186-hv.o obj-m += tegra_bpmp.o endif diff --git a/drivers/scsi/ufs/ufs-provision.h b/drivers/scsi/ufs/ufs-provision.h index ef743203..5ac6d9da 100644 --- a/drivers/scsi/ufs/ufs-provision.h +++ b/drivers/scsi/ufs/ufs-provision.h @@ -17,6 +17,15 @@ #include void debugfs_provision_init(struct ufs_hba *hba, struct dentry *device_root); void debugfs_provision_exit(struct ufs_hba *hba); +#else +static inline void debugfs_provision_init(struct ufs_hba *hba, struct dentry *device_root) +{ + return; +} +static inline void debugfs_provision_exit(struct ufs_hba *hba) +{ + return; +} #endif #endif diff --git a/drivers/scsi/ufs/ufs-tegra-common.c b/drivers/scsi/ufs/ufs-tegra-common.c index fe68da2c..99ca1901 100644 --- a/drivers/scsi/ufs/ufs-tegra-common.c +++ b/drivers/scsi/ufs/ufs-tegra-common.c @@ -19,9 +19,7 @@ #include #include -#ifdef CONFIG_DEBUG_FS #include -#endif #if LINUX_VERSION_CODE < KERNEL_VERSION(5, 16, 0) #include